Section 201.12.2. Informal settlement.  


Latest version.
  • The director or the respondent may request that an informal conference be held to determine whether the noncompliance matter can be resolved in a just manner in furtherance of the public interest. Neither the director nor respondent is required to use this informal procedure. If the director and respondent agree to negotiate a settlement, the various points of the settlement, including a stipulated statement of facts, shall be set forth in writing and shall be binding on both parties.
